Most not long ago, it's been discovered that conolidine and the above mentioned derivatives act over the atypical chemokine receptor three (ACKR3. Expressed in comparable spots as classical opioid receptors, it binds to the big selection of endogenous opioids. Unlike most opioid receptors, this receptor functions being a scavenger and will not activate a 2nd messenger program (59). As talked about by Meyrath et al., this also indicated a probable hyperlink in between these receptors along with the endogenous opiate program (59). This review in the long run determined the ACKR3 receptor did not create any G protein signal response by measuring and locating no mini G protein interactions, unlike classical opiate receptors, which recruit these proteins for signaling.

Conolidine is really a monoterpene indole alkaloid derived from Tabernaemontana divaricata, a flowering plant native to tropical and subtropical locations of Asia, Africa, as well as the Pacific. Often called the pinwheel flower or crepe jasmine, this plant has been Employed in conventional medication for hundreds of years, specifically in Ayurvedic and Chinese tactics. Extracts from its leaves, stems, and roots are already made use of for his or her analgesic and anti-inflammatory properties, however the Energetic compounds were not completely comprehended until current pharmacological reports determined conolidine as a vital contributor. Structurally, conolidine belongs towards the indole alkaloid course, known for assorted Organic pursuits. Not like analgesic alkaloids such as morphine or quinine, conolidine lacks a nitrogenous fundamental Heart, which usually influences opioid receptor binding.
